MENCETAK N BILANGAN PRIMA
// By Eko Purwanto W H
#include
#include
void main()
{
int i, j, n, jum=0;
bool prima;
printf ("\n==============================\n");
printf ("\nDeret N Bilangan Prima Pertama");
printf ( "\n==============================\n\n");
printf ("Masukkan n = ");
scanf("%d",&n);
while (n > 100)
{
printf ("\n\nMaksimal 100 bilangan prima pertama\nMasukkan n = ");
scanf("%d",n);
}
printf("\n");
if (i==2)
{
prima=true;
}
else
{
for (i=2;i<=545;i++)
{
if (i % j==0)
{
prima=false;
break; // keluar dari looping
}
else
{
prima=true;
}
}
if (prima) // prima = true
{
jum+=1; // menghitung banyaknya bilangan prima
if (jum<=n)
{
printf ("%d\t",i);
}
}
}
printf("\n\n");
getch();
}
0 komentar:
Posting Komentar